Best time to visit Auckland

New Zealand · 20-year averages

January is the best month in Auckland, scoring 84 out of 100, with July the weakest at 51. The 33-point spread means timing is worth planning around without being decisive. 6 of the twelve months sit within ten points of the best, so there is more than one right answer.

February is the warmest month at 23.7 °C and July the coolest at 13.8 °C — a 9.9 °C spread across the year. It never reaches 30 °C in an average year, which takes heat off the list of reasons to avoid any particular month.

There is a real wet season here. May to August carry the rain — up to 16 wet days in a month — while January to March drop as low as 8. That 8-day gap is the biggest single difference between a good month and a bad one in Auckland, and it moves further than the temperature does.

The sea is comfortable for swimming in February — 21 °C at its warmest against 14.7 °C at its coldest. The water peaks a month or two after the air does, so the best swimming falls later in the year than the best weather. Daylight runs from 9.7 hours in winter to 14.7 in summer, enough to notice on a sightseeing itinerary.

The three strongest months are January, February, March. The one to think twice about is July. Each month below has its own page with rainfall reliability, extremes, daylight, sea temperature and crowd levels.
